12 روش مرتب سازی و پوشه بندی رسانه ها
بهینه سازی رسانه به فرآیند بهبود و بهبود فایل های رسانه ای مانند تصاویر، ویدئوها و صداها اشاره دارد تا اطمینان حاصل شود که برای پلتفرم ها و دستگاه های مختلف بهینه شده اند. این شامل بهینه سازی اندازه، فرمت، کیفیت و ابرداده فایل است. برای کمک به درک مراحل مربوط به بهینه سازی رسانه،
مرحله 1: مخاطبان هدف خود را بشناسید قبل از بهینه سازی فایل های رسانه ای خود، بسیار مهم است که درک روشنی از مخاطبان هدف خود داشته باشید. پلتفرمها و دستگاههایی را که بیشتر استفاده میکنند شناسایی کنید، زیرا این کار بر تکنیکهای بهینهسازی که استفاده میکنید تأثیر میگذارد.
مرحله 2: فرمت فایل مناسب را انتخاب کنید انتخاب فرمت فایل مناسب برای فایل های رسانه ای برای بهینه سازی ضروری است. فرمت های مختلف سطوح مختلفی از فشرده سازی دارند و از ویژگی های متفاوتی پشتیبانی می کنند. فرمتهای رایج تصویر شامل JPEG، PNG و GIF هستند، در حالی که فرمتهای ویدیویی محبوب شامل MP4 و WebM هستند.
مرحله 3: فشرده سازی تصاویر یکی از موثرترین راه ها برای بهینه سازی تصاویر، فشرده سازی آنها است. فشرده سازی تصویر حجم فایل را بدون کاهش قابل توجهی در کیفیت کاهش می دهد. ابزارهای مختلفی در دسترس هستند که می توانند تصاویر را با حفظ یکپارچگی بصری فشرده کنند.
مرحله 4: بهینه سازی فایل های ویدئویی مانند تصاویر، ویدئوها نیز می توانند از طریق تکنیک های فشرده سازی بهینه شوند. فشردهسازی ویدیو با حذف دادههای غیرضروری و حفظ کیفیت بصری، حجم فایل را کاهش میدهد. ابزارهایی مانند HandBrake و FFmpeg می توانند به بهینه سازی موثر فایل های ویدئویی کمک کنند.
مرحله 5: کاهش اندازه فایل صوتی برای بهینه سازی فایل های صوتی، کاهش اندازه آنها بسیار مهم است. تکنیکهای فشردهسازی صدا مانند کاهش نرخ بیت و انتخاب کدک میتوانند به میزان قابل توجهی اندازه فایل را بدون کاهش قابل توجه کیفیت صدا کاهش دهند.
مرحله 6: اجرای طراحی واکنشگرا اطمینان حاصل کنید که وب سایت یا برنامه شما به صورت واکنش گرا طراحی شده است تا اندازه و وضوح صفحه نمایش متفاوتی را برآورده کند. این تضمین می کند که فایل های رسانه ای به طور مطلوب در همه دستگاه ها نمایش داده می شوند و تجربه کاربری یکپارچه را ارائه می دهند.
مرحله 7: استفاده از بارگذاری تنبل بارگیری تنبل تکنیکی است که بارگیری فایل های رسانه ای نامرئی را تا زمانی که نیاز باشد به تعویق می اندازد. این به بهبود زمان بارگذاری صفحه، به ویژه برای وب سایت هایی با فایل های رسانه ای متعدد کمک می کند. بارگذاری تنبل را می توان با استفاده از کتابخانه ها یا چارچوب های جاوا اسکریپت پیاده سازی کرد.
مرحله 8: بهینه سازی متادیتا ابرداده نقش مهمی در بهینه سازی رسانه ایفا می کند. ابردادههای مرتبط مانند برچسبهای جایگزین، زیرنویسها و توضیحات را به تصاویر و ویدیوها اضافه کنید. این نه تنها دسترسی را بهبود می بخشد، بلکه به موتورهای جستجو کمک می کند محتوای رسانه ای شما را بهتر درک کنند.
مرحله 9: فعال کردن حافظه پنهان اجرای مکانیسمهای ذخیرهسازی به فایلهای رسانه اجازه میدهد تا پس از بارگیری اولیه بهطور موقت در دستگاههای کاربران ذخیره شوند. این امر نیاز به دانلودهای مکرر را کاهش می دهد و سرعت کلی صفحه و تجربه کاربری را بهبود می بخشد.
مرحله 10: از شبکههای تحویل محتوا (CDN) استفاده کنید CDNها به توزیع فایلهای رسانهای شما در چندین سرور در سراسر جهان کمک میکنند و فاصله بین کاربران و فایلهایی را که درخواست میکنند کاهش میدهند. این امر سرعت تحویل را بهبود می بخشد و عملکرد بهینه را بدون توجه به مکان کاربر تضمین می کند.
مرحله 11: بهینه سازی تصاویر کوچک و پیش نمایش ها تصاویر کوچک و پیش نمایش ها اغلب برای ارائه پیش نمایش محتوای رسانه استفاده می شوند. بهینه سازی این نسخه های کوچکتر از فایل های رسانه ای برای کاهش اندازه فایل و حفظ وضوح بصری ضروری است.
مرحله 12: به طور منظم نظارت و به روز رسانی کنید بهینه سازی رسانه یک فرآیند مداوم است. به طور منظم بر عملکرد وب سایت یا برنامه خود نظارت داشته باشید و برای اطمینان از ارائه بهینه رسانه، به روز رسانی های لازم را انجام دهید.
با دنبال کردن این مراحل، میتوانید فایلهای رسانهای خود را برای پلتفرمها و دستگاههای مختلف بهینه کنید و تجربه کاربر و عملکرد کلی را افزایش دهید.
منابع :
- Google Developers - Google Developers مستندات جامعی در مورد شیوههای توسعه وب، از جمله تکنیکهای بهینهسازی رسانه ارائه میکند.
- W3Schools - W3Schools یک منبع شناخته شده برای آموزش های توسعه وب، از جمله راهنماهای بهینه سازی فایل های رسانه ای است.
- مجله Smashing - مجله Smashing مقالات و راهنماهای عمیقی را در مورد موضوعات مختلف توسعه وب، از جمله استراتژی های بهینه سازی رسانه ارائه می دهد.